Getting things to Australia from India Dear Alemu, Mixies etc are allowed.The best way to get anything right frm pickles & spices is to put a label (as in commercial masala packets).Whole spices/plant materials/fruits are not allowed. The best way to find out wld be visit the quarantine website: www.australia.gov.au/Customs_<WBR>&_Quarantine_for_Migrants I hope this helps, Cheers, Corallux
